Cuoco and Co. Real Estate is a leading real estate brokerage serving Western Massachusetts and Northern Connecticut. Under the experienced leadership of Broker Owner Brenda Cuoco, the team has achieved remarkable success, ranking as the #1 team in the Realtor Association of the Pioneer Valley for 2024 and closing over $399 million in sales since 2019. Renowned for exceptional customer service and unparalleled results, Cuoco and Co. specializes in residential, multifamily, and land transactions, leveraging deep local expertise to deliver outstanding outcomes for their clients.
